Why Weekly Training Matters
Unlike one-off camps or casual recreational leagues, weekly soccer training offers consistency — a vital factor in the physical and mental development of young athletes. Regular sessions help children build muscle memory, develop coordination, and improve their understanding of the game over time. More importantly, it creates a routine that reinforces discipline, resilience, and confidence.

Age-Specific Coaching
We Make Footballers divides players into three age categories to ensure age-appropriate training:
- Ages 4–6: Emphasis is on fun, movement, balance, and simple ball control. At this stage, children learn through play and grow comfortable with the ball.
- Ages 7–9: Players are introduced to more technical skills such as passing, dribbling, shooting, and basic tactical awareness. Social development and teamwork are also a focus.
- Ages 10–12: More advanced players begin to develop match intelligence, positional play, and faster decision-making on the field.
This progression-based model ensures that players are always challenged but never overwhelmed.
